'Deborah S. Hechinger is the president and CEO of "BoardSource. BoardSource offers governance consulting, public training, practical information and tools to increase the effectiveness of nonprofit boards of directors. She joined BoardSource in October 2003.

"Debbie is a co-convener of the Panel on the Nonprofit Sector’s Governance and Fiduciary Responsibility Workgroup and has been actively involved in shaping recommendations to the Senate Finance Committee on ways to improve the oversight and governance of charitable organizations. She speaks at conferences and workshops throughout the United States and advises boards and senior staff of nonprofit organizations as a senior governance consultant.

"Debbie has held key leadership positions on the boards of Sidwell Friend’s School and the Children’s National Medical Center in addition to having served on the boards of the Washington Scholarship Fund and the Black Student Fund.

"Prior to joining BoardSource, Debbie served as executive vice president of the World Wildlife Fund where she was responsible for all fundraising, communication, and operations activities. Previously, she was Deputy Comptroller as well as Director of Securities and Corporate Practice at the Comptroller of the Currency. From 1974 to 1983, she held senior executive positions in the Division of Enforcement at the Securities and Exchange Commission.

"Debbie received her B.A. from Brown University and a J.D. from Georgetown University Law Center. She is currently a member in good standing of the District of Columbia Bar." [1]

She is married to John W. Hechinger, Jr..
